Why Industry Leaders Matter
Choosing a leader means you get experience you can trust. These firms have handled thousands of projects, so they know how to avoid common pitfalls – from hidden mold problems to weak foundations. Their track record also means they stay up‑to‑date with the latest materials, like engineered hardwood or luxury vinyl plank, which can boost durability and style.
Leaders also push the industry forward. When a big builder adopts a new sustainable material, suppliers follow suit, making greener options more affordable for everyone. That ripple effect helps you get a modern, eco‑friendly floor without paying a premium.
How to Spot a Real Leader
First, check for clear cost guides. Companies that publish a roof payment breakdown or a foundation‑repair cost estimate are being transparent about pricing. Transparency is a hallmark of a leader – they’ll tell you exactly what you’re paying for and why.
Second, look at their online content. Posts about scatter cushion rules, modern living‑room ideas, or bathroom upgrade tips show they understand interior trends and can advise you beyond just installation.
Third, verify certifications and warranty terms. A leader will offer at least a 10‑year guarantee on floor materials and a quick response team for any post‑install issues.
For commercial projects, a solid portfolio of completed offices, hotels, or retail spaces lets you see real‑world results. If you can view before‑and‑after photos, you’ll get a better sense of the finish and quality you can expect.
